Overview of Precast Concrete Panels in Gippsland

What are precast concrete panels and how they work

Across Gippsland, a growing chorus of builders turns to precast concrete panels gippsland for reliable, weatherproof shells. Early data suggests up to 30% faster assembly and fewer on-site delays. These are factory-made wall and floor units poured and cured in controlled conditions, then transported to site and joined with precision. Joints are sealed and finishes integrated, delivering consistent performance in a region famed for changing weather and coastal exposure.

  • Factory-controlled quality and weather resistance that reduces on-site risk
  • Less waste and shorter construction cycles thanks to modular assembly
  • Design flexibility with textures, openings, and integrated finishes

Key materials, finishes, and design options for precast panels in Gippsland

Gippsland’s wind-tested landscapes reveal durability in quiet measures. Last year, the region logged a 22% uptick in precast adoption, a signal that precast concrete panels gippsland are more than practical—they arrive already singing. I’ve watched them arrive as seasoned instruments, ready to sing through wind and salt.

Key materials begin with high-strength concrete mixes, graded aggregates, and pigment-rich finishes. Inside, insulated cores and moisture barriers cut on-site risk while factory curing locks in performance. The result is a weatherproof shell that handles salt air and shifting seasons with fewer surprises—an especially welcome truth for South Africa’s coastal projects aiming for predictability and elegance.

Design choices flow from texture to openings to integrated finishes.

  • Timber-grain textures
  • Brick-face or smooth exteriors
  • Window and door openings integrated into the panel
  • Color-matched joints and sealants

Technical and regulatory considerations

Structural design and engineering integration

In Gippsland’s gusty embrace, precast concrete panels gippsland arrive like a weathered sea wall—efficient, enduring, and quietly magical. A striking statistic: projects embracing precast panels report up to 40% faster on-site assembly, transforming weather windows into productive hours.

Technical and regulatory considerations shape every panel’s journey from factory to site. Design teams navigate codes, fire ratings, wind, and seismic needs, while factory QC guarantees consistency and performance.

  • Design adherence to local codes and standards (AS/NZS and SANS guidance as applicable)
  • Durability and coastal corrosion protection
  • Clear coordination for lifting, temporary works, and interface with services

Structural design and engineering integration center on seamless interaction with frames and MEP. Engineers map load paths, joints, and seals to ensure precast concrete panels gippsland work with anchors and insulation, delivering reliable performance and refined form.

Estimating costs, lead times, and budgeting considerations

Choosing a Gippsland precast supplier hinges on the alchemy of cost, cadence, and craft. Costs must be read beyond the sticker price—transport, tolerances, and installation shape the final budget. Lead times demand clarity: what can be shipped when, and what buffers are acceptable against weather and holidays? A respected supplier translates design intent into factory-ready pieces with precision, delivering precast concrete panels gippsland that meet the architecture’s rhythm and weather performance.

Budgeting conversations should surface early, mapping every cost driver and trade-off. The procurement narrative benefits from a transparent breakdown that covers the main cost categories and the delivery sequence. For readers in South Africa, distance and customs may influence timing and price, but the core principle holds: clarity around expectations reduces the risk of surprises as the project advances.

  • Transparent cost components, including materials, fabrication, delivery, and installation
  • Realistic lead times with weather buffers and holiday calendars
  • Post-install support, maintenance guidance, and warranty terms
